Noah (Nooh)
In the name of Allah, the Entirely Merciful, the Especially Merciful
We sent Noah to his people telling him, "Warn your people before a painful torment approaches them". 1 He said: "O my people! Verily, I am a plain warner to you, 2 [Saying], 'Worship Allah, fear Him and obey me. 3 He will forgive you some of your faults and grant you a delay to an appointed term; surely the term of Allah when it comes is not postponed; did you but know! 4 He said: O my Lord! surely I have called my people by night and by day! 5 but my call has only increased them in running away. 6 “And whenever I called them, so that You may forgive them, they always thrust their fingers into their ears, and covered themselves with their clothes, and remained stubborn and were extremely haughty.” 7 And lo! I have called unto them aloud, 8 and spoke to them in public and in private." 9 And I told them: 'Ask your Lord to forgive you. He is verily forgiving. 10 He will send you abundant rain from the sky, 11 And will give you increase of wealth and sons, and give you gardens and springs of water. 12 What is the matter with you that you deny the greatness of God, 13 when He has created you through different stages of existence? 14 Have you not seen how Allah created the seven heavens one above the other, 15 And has made the moon a light therein, and made the sun a lamp? 16 And Allah hath caused you to grow from the earth as a growth. 17 Then He returns you to it, then will He bring you forth a (new) bringing forth: 18 And Allah has made for you the earth wide spread (an expanse). 19 That you may follow therein roads of passage.'
